The parties agree that Contractor shall have the status of and shall perform all work under this contract as an
independent contractor, maintaining control over all its consultants, sub consultants, contractors, or subcontractors.
The only contractual relationship created by this contract is between the Owner and Contractor, and nothing in this
contract shall create any contractual relationship between the Owner and Contractor’s consultants, sub consultants,
contractors, or subcontractors. The parties also agree that Contractor is not the Owner’s employee and that there shall
be no:

(1) Withholding of income taxes by the Owner:

(2) Industrial insurance coverage provided by the Owner;

(3) Participation in group insurance plans which may be available to employees of the Owner;

(4) Participation or contributions by either the independent contractor or the Owner to the public employee’s
retirement system;

(5) Accumulation of vacation leave or sick leave provided by the Owner;

(6) Unemployment compensation coverage provided by the Owner.

§ 11.2 OWNER’S LIABILITY INSURANCE
The Owner shall be responsible for purchasing and maintaining the Owner’s usual liability insurance.

§ 11.3 PROPERTY INSURANCE

§ 11.3.1 Unless otherwise provided, the Contractor shall purchase and maintain, in a company or companies lawfully
authorized to do business in the jurisdiction in which the Project is located, property insurance written on a builder’s
risk “all-risk” or equivalent policy form in the amount of the initial Contract Sum, plus value of subsequent Contract
Modifications and cost of materials supplied or installed by others, comprising total value for the entire Project at the
site on a replacement cost basis without optional deductibles. Such property insurance shall be maintained, unless
otherwise provided in the Contract Documents or otherwise agreed in writing by all persons and entities who are
beneficiaries of such insurance, until final payment has been made as provided in Section 9.10 or until no person or
entity other than the Owner has an insurable interest in the property required by this Section 11.3 to be covered,
whichever is later. This insurance shall include interests of the Owner, the Contractor, Subcontractors and
Sub-subcontractors in the Project.
